Steven Albini Beats Stud Specialist Jeff Lisandro to Claim 2018 WSOP $1,500 Seven Card Stud Crown

Aside from a successful career as a musician and record producer, Steven Albini now has a major poker accomplishment to boast about. Albini successfully navigated through a number of poker heavyweights in the 2018 WSOP $1,500 Seven Card Stud to be crowned the event’s champion for his first gold bracelet and $105,629 in prize money.

The event saw 310 entries pay the buy-in to take aim at the title. After three days of play, Albini secured a spot among the final eight. The tournament’s official final table was represented by three multiple gold bracelet winners, two of whom – Jeff Lisandro and Chris Ferguson, were each vying for their seventh piece. It is also important to note that Lisandro has worn the Stud crown multiple times over the years, which made him the most feared opponent in contention.

Facing seasoned opponents had apparently not scared Albini that much. The player admitted that he considered himself a mediocre player, but still he pointed out that he was very comfortable playing stud and that combined with his terrific run over the past few days came of great help in his pursuit of the title.

Albini went on to say that socializing with fellow poker players improved his game and how he felt at the table significantly. Matt Ashton, a former Poker Players Championship champ, had been a great mentor to Albini, the brand new WSOP gold bracelet winner further revealed.

Heads-Up Action

Albini was keen to admit that he had not had much heads-up experience in stud prior to last night when he ended up playing against none other but one of the most widely decorated players to have entered the tournament.

The heads-up match began with Albini holding a very slight lead over his final opponent. It all showed that it would be a long and grueling duel, and that proved case. Lisandro quickly doubled to take the lead. The two players traded the chip lead multiple times over the course of heads-up play, until Albini tied the stacks after winning a couple of smaller pots, then emerged the chip leader to never look back. Just several hands later, he finished off his much more experienced opponent.

Lisandro took a consolation prize of $65,629 for his runner-up finish in the tournament. A seventh gold bracelet eluded the player but with the WSOP still being in its initial stages, we will certainly be seeing more of him.

As for Albini, he added $105,629 to his previous WSOP winnings, which totaled a little over $55,000 prior to last night. The players has now cashed in six events from the series.

The $1,500 Seven Card Stud drew 310 entries who created a $418,500 prize pool. The top 47 finishers were rewarded with the portion of the money, with minimum payouts starting from $2,250. Each of the eight final tablists was guaranteed $8,355.
